Breaking Down the Features of Zippo Ford Mustang Lighter ZO71912
Specifications
This Zippo lighter boasts several key specifications that contribute to its functionality and iconic status. It measures approximately 0.5 inches in width and 2.25 inches in height, a compact size that fits comfortably in a pocket or tool pouch. The build is primarily metal, with the distinctive Black Crackle finish adding to its tactile appeal and grip.
The 0.16 lb weight gives it a reassuring heft, indicating solid construction. This weight is standard for Zippo lighters and contributes to their wind-resistant design. The Black Crackle finish is not just cosmetic; it’s designed for enhanced grip, which is particularly useful in workshop or outdoor settings.
These specifications translate into practical benefits: its compact dimensions make it highly portable, while the robust metal construction and textured finish contribute to its durability and ease of handling. The classic Zippo mechanism, refined over decades, ensures consistent performance.

Durability & Maintenance
In terms of durability, Zippo lighters are renowned for their longevity, and this model is no exception. Built with a sturdy metal case, it’s designed to withstand typical daily wear and tear. I have yet to see any significant damage or performance degradation after my testing period, and I anticipate it lasting for many years with proper care.
Maintenance is straightforward and consists primarily of refilling the fuel reservoir and occasionally replacing the flint and wick. These are user-replaceable parts that are readily available. One point of caution is to use only genuine Zippo fuel to avoid clogging the wick and flint mechanism. Failure to do so can lead to inconsistent performance or premature wear.
